EcoZD project refines cross-country, trans-disciplinary collaboration on zoonotic diseases in Southeast Asia

Between 10-13 December 2011, the International Livestock Research Institute (ILRI) led project on ecosystem approaches to the better management of zoonotic emerging infectious diseases in Southeast Asia (EcoZD) convened a progress meeting  in Bangkok.
